We are looking for a motivated and reliable Hazardous Waste Site Operative to join our client’s Stourport facility. This is an exciting opportunity to be part of a team that ensures the safe and efficient handling of hazardous wastes, including oils and packaged materials. You’ll play a key role in the day‑to‑day operations of the site, from receiving, processing waste to storage and dispatch, all while maintaining the highest standards of Health, Safety, and Environmental compliance.

Our client values being Smart, Honest, Reliable, working Together, and having Fun – and they want you to bring these values to life in your role.

Key Responsibilities
  • Support the Site Supervisor with daily operational tasks including receiving, testing, offloading, storing, and recording waste materials.
  • Ensure all operations comply with site procedures, permits, and legal requirements.
  • Store wastes correctly according to site procedures and permitted activities.
  • Accurately record site data, including load details, stock levels, and non‑conformances, using the vehicle weighbridge system.
  • Maintain excellent housekeeping and ensure all operational and mess areas are clean and tidy.
  • Communicate clearly with drivers, visitors, and colleagues across the wider team.
  • Operate forklifts to safely move waste from vehicles.
  • Identify tasks proactively and work as part of a team to support site efficiency.
  • Flexibility to work overtime when required.
